Understanding the Automatic Starter System
Before we dive into pricing, let’s level-set on what we're even talking about. An automatic starter system, sometimes referred to as a remote starter, allows you to start your vehicle's engine remotely, typically from the comfort of your home or office. This is especially handy in extreme weather conditions – preheating the car on a cold winter morning or cooling it down on a scorching summer day.

Key Specs and Main Parts
The automatic starter system isn't just one piece; it's a collection of components working in harmony. Here's a breakdown of the essential parts:
- Remote Transmitter (Key Fob): This is the device you use to send the start command to your vehicle. It usually operates via radio frequency (RF) or Bluetooth. Range and features (like two-way communication, which confirms the start command was received) impact the price.
- Receiver/Control Module: This unit is installed in your vehicle and receives the signal from the remote transmitter. It processes the command and initiates the starting sequence. This is often the most expensive individual component.
- Hood Switch: A crucial safety feature! This switch prevents the car from starting remotely if the hood is open, protecting anyone working under the hood.
- Tachometer Wire (or equivalent): This wire is used to monitor the engine's RPM (revolutions per minute). The control module uses this signal to ensure the engine starts successfully and doesn't over-rev. Some newer systems use digital signals from the vehicle's CAN bus.
- Wiring Harness: All the wires and connectors needed to integrate the automatic starter system into your vehicle's electrical system.
- Brake Shutdown Wire: Another critical safety feature. Pressing the brake pedal disables the remote start, preventing accidental movement of the vehicle.
- Neutral Safety Switch Wire (for manual transmissions): This prevents the vehicle from starting in gear. Extremely important for manual transmission vehicles.
- Optional Components: Features like smartphone integration, GPS tracking, and security system integration will increase the overall cost.
How It Works (Simplified)
Here's a simplified overview of the starting process:
- You press the start button on the remote transmitter.
- The transmitter sends a radio frequency (RF) signal to the receiver/control module in your car.
- The receiver verifies the signal and initiates the starting sequence.
- The control module checks the safety switches (hood switch, brake switch, neutral safety switch for manual transmissions).
- If all safety checks pass, the control module activates the starter motor, just like turning the key in the ignition.
- The engine starts, and the control module monitors the RPM via the tachometer wire.
- If the engine doesn't start after a set number of attempts, the control module aborts the starting sequence.
Real-World Use and Basic Troubleshooting
Even with proper installation, problems can arise. Here are a few common issues and troubleshooting tips:
- Car Doesn't Start: Check the remote's battery. Make sure the hood is completely closed. Verify the brake pedal isn't slightly depressed. Ensure the battery voltage is sufficient.
- Remote Doesn't Work: Replace the remote's battery. Try reprogramming the remote to the receiver (refer to your system's manual). Interference from other RF devices can sometimes cause issues.
- Engine Starts and Dies: This often indicates a problem with the tachometer wire connection or incorrect tachometer programming. The control module isn't properly monitoring the engine's RPM.
Safety – Highlight Risky Components
Working with your car's electrical system can be dangerous. Here are some safety precautions:
- Disconnect the Battery: Always disconnect the negative (-) battery terminal before working on any electrical components. This prevents accidental shorts and potential damage to your vehicle's electronics.
- Airbags: Be extremely careful when working near airbags. Accidental deployment can cause serious injury. If you are not comfortable working around airbags, consult a professional.
- Wiring: Incorrect wiring can damage your vehicle's computer (ECU) or other sensitive components. Double-check all connections and consult wiring diagrams.
- Professional Installation: If you're unsure about any aspect of the installation, it's best to have a professional install the system.
Key Specs and Main Parts – Delving Deeper
To really understand the costs involved, let's delve deeper into the specifications and components:
- Range: Remote starter range can vary dramatically, from a few hundred feet to over a mile. Longer range systems generally cost more. Range is usually specified in open-air conditions; obstacles like buildings will reduce the effective range.
- Two-Way Communication: Systems with two-way communication provide confirmation that the start command was received and executed. This is a valuable feature but adds to the cost.
- Smartphone Integration: Some systems allow you to start your car from your smartphone. This often requires a subscription service and adds a significant cost.
- Security System Integration: Many automatic starters can be integrated with existing security systems, providing additional features like alarm arming/disarming.
- Data Bus Integration: Newer vehicles use a CAN bus (Controller Area Network) to communicate between different electronic modules. Some automatic starters can interface directly with the CAN bus, simplifying installation and providing access to more features. These systems often require specialized programming tools.
The Cost Breakdown: What You're Really Paying For
Now, let’s get to the question you really want answered: How much does an automatic starter cost?
- Basic System (DIY Installation): A basic, no-frills automatic starter can cost anywhere from $50 to $150. These systems typically have limited range and features.
- Mid-Range System (DIY Installation): A mid-range system with longer range, two-way communication, and potentially smartphone compatibility might cost between $150 and $300.
- High-End System (DIY Installation): High-end systems with all the bells and whistles can easily exceed $300 or even $500.
- Professional Installation: Labor costs for professional installation can range from $150 to $500, depending on the complexity of the installation and the hourly rate of the installer. Vehicles with complex electrical systems, particularly those with immobilizer systems that require bypass modules, will typically incur higher labor costs.
- Bypass Modules: Many newer vehicles have immobilizer systems that prevent the car from starting without the original key present. To install an automatic starter on these vehicles, you'll need a bypass module, which can cost between $50 and $200.
Important Considerations: The make and model of your vehicle significantly impact the cost. Some vehicles require more complex installation procedures or specialized bypass modules. Also, the quality of the system itself matters. Cheaper systems may be less reliable and prone to failure.
